Adjusting Tenses in Prompts

Specifying tense in your prompts guides the AI to produce content in the correct timeframe. Here are examples of prompts for different tenses:

  • Present tense: “Write a paragraph describing the benefits of renewable energy.”
  • Past tense: “Describe the events that led to the fall of the Roman Empire.”
  • Future tense: “Explain how artificial intelligence will impact education in the next decade.”

Customizing Writing Styles

To influence the style, include descriptive language or specify the tone you want. Examples:

  • Formal style: “Provide a formal analysis of the causes of World War I.”
  • Casual style: “Tell me how you would explain ancient Egypt to a friend.”
  • Creative style: “Write a short story set in medieval times with a mysterious twist.”

Combining Tense and Style in Prompts

For more precise results, combine tense and style instructions in your prompts. Examples:

  • Present, formal: “Provide a formal explanation of climate change.”
  • Past, casual: “Describe a fun day at the park from your childhood.”
  • Future, creative: “Imagine a future city and describe it in a poetic style.”
